Credit: UoS Engagement Seren and the Polar Bear Cub: children's fiction book
Get your free signed copy of the children's fiction book written by astronomer Dr Sadie Jones - and meet Sadie!
The book is about a young girl called Seren who is neurodivergent and accidentally ends up on an adventure in Svalbard to rescue some kidnapped space scientists from the University of Southampton. Seren also makes friends with a polar bear cub called Lova and you can meet Lova's mother, Urzsula at the event and get your photo with her.
Sadie took inspiration for the book from her expedition to observe the aurora in Svalbard, Norway with the university's Space Environment Physics group.
